Sign In — Free (10 views/day)SPECIAL TREATMENT EDUCATION & PREVENTION SERVICES INC, founded in 1977, is a community nonprofit in the Crime & Legal sector that reported $2.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 15% compared to the prior year. The organization ran a surplus of $569K, a strong 25% operating margin.
THE MISSION OF STEPS IS TO PROMOTE COMMUNITY AWARENESS AND INDIVIDUAL RECOVERY THROUGH SAFETY, EDUCATION AND SUBSTANCE ABUSE COUNSELING. THE MAJOR PORTION OF THE PROGRAM FOCUSES ON THOSE WHO HAVE BEEN CONVICTED OF DRIVING UNDER THE INFLUENCE OF ALCOHOL OR DRUGS. STEPS PROVIDES EDUCATION, GROUP AND INDIVIDUAL COUNSELING TO HELP THE PARTICIPANTS AVOID DRIVING UNDER THE INFLUENCE AND RE-OFFENDING. STEPS ALSO OFFERS TRAFFIC SCHOOL INSTRUCTION TO INDIVIDUALS WHO HAVE RECEIVED A TRAFFIC CITATION.A VARIETY OF PREVENTION SERVICES ARE ALSO OFFERED, INCLUDING EDUCATION INCLUDING FOCUSING ON UNDERAGE DRINKERS AS WELL AS THOSE WHO ARE OVER-SERVED ALCOHOL. THE RESPONSIBLE BEVERAGE SERVICE TRAINING PROVIDES SERVICES AT A VARIETY OF SITES THROUGHOUT KERN COUNTY AND THE SURROUNDING AREA.
